resolvconf (1.40) unstable; urgency=low

  [ Daniel Kahn Gillmor ]
  * update.d/dnscache: moved runit service directory from /var/service to
    /etc/service, tracking #461478. Added Conflicts: runit (<< 1.8.0-3)
    to make sure the system uses the same path.
  * update.d/dnscache: changing directories back from $SERVICEDIR after
    scanning so that list-records works properly.

  [ Thomas Hood ]
  * Overwrite /etc/resolvconf/run symlink by means of "ln -nsf" rather
    than by means of "ln -sf" since the latter just (uselessly) puts a
    new symlink _in_ the run directory. Thanks to Karl Chen for pointing
    out the error. (Closes: #475528)
  * [Debconf translation updates]
  * Italian (Closes: #471889)
  * Spanish (Closes: #473470)

resolvconf (1.39) unstable; urgency=low

  [ Daniel Kahn Gillmor ]
  * Removed bashism from dnscache script (Closes: #459566)
    Thanks, Jeff King!

  [ Thomas Hood ]
  * Add a variable giving the admin the ability to disable the not-always-
    so-popular "truncate the nameserver list after 127.*" feature
    (Closes: #339418, #404041, #425444, #462946)
  * Change dhcp3 dhclient hook script so that it sends domain name and
    domain search strings separately to resolvconf preceded by the
    "domain" and "search" keywords, respectively. (Closes: #460609)
  * Add information about dns- options to resolvconf.8 (Closes: #305884)
  * Clean up dnscache script
  * Add pere to Uploaders list
  * Check before migrating files from /dev/shm/resolvconf/* (Closes: #463463)
  * Add debian/compat, make lintian happy
  * Debconf templates and debian/control reviewed by the debian-l10n-english
    team as part of the Smith review project. (Closes: #464499)
